We are always looking for people to contribute to our documentation. It could be anything from a "getting started" type article to controlling a canine robot! Content is always needed and welcome to keep the wiki alive. So, don't be afraid to make changes to our wiki.

Mediawiki

In order to maintain uniformity and prevent fragmentation, our primary platform and hub for documentation is the MinnowBoard portal on elinux which is powered by Mediawiki.

What can you contribute?

Anything that helps the community is always welcome. You are more than welcome to share your knowledge. Areas of interest include, but are not limited to:

  • "How to" type articles
  • Projects/hacks
  • Troubleshooting
  • Advanced topics

Tips and Tricks

When you are done writing your article/document, please remember to add the "MinnowBoard" category at the end as shown below:

[[Category: MinnowBoard]]
